30A WEEKEND TRAVEL GUIDE

So as most of you know I live on 30A, and absolutely love it. Everyone always asks me where to eat, stay, and what to see, so I thought I'd make a post about it! Happy travels!

Starting off: What to see!

There is so much beauty up and down 30A. From Gulf Place to Inlet, you really can't go wrong! Regardless of where you stay, it only takes around 30 mins to get from one end of 30A to the other. As long as you have a car, you can pretty much see everything!


Besides the beach, I would definitely start in Seaside Square. You can take a look at the tower, walk around the shops, and grab a bite to eat at one of the many food trucks in the area! Growing up, we used to stay in WaterColor, which is the town over, and I would ride my bike into the square every single day. The Meltdown Grilled Cheese is what I would live on on during vacation here! You do have to pay to park here, but by the hour it isn't too bad! Be prepared for the crowds, but it is definitely the spot to see.

Over in WaterSound, The Big Chill is another great spot. My family and I always ride our bikes up here to watch football games on the big screen, eat lunch, and just hang out! Luke Bryan's cigar shop is here, as well as a few other fun boutiques.


Alys Beach is where all the matching white buildings you have probably seen are. I would definitely stop through here and take a look around! George's is a great restraunt for dinner if you can get in... They do not take reservations and open at 5 for dinner. Get there at 4:30 if you want a spot! When I am home, I work at Merit, right across the street. Stop in, shop around, and come say hi!





Last but not least, Rosemary Beach is a must-see. This little town has so many shops to see. There is a farmers market every Sunday year round, which my family and I love going to! We never fail to get some Noli South Kombucha, as well as some snacks along the way.


Eats!

The food on 30A is seriously one of a kind. I made a blog post a while back of all my favorite restaurants here. However, if you are only in town for the weekend, I have a few I would recommend! If you are into the fine dining experience, I definitely recommend Gallion's in Rosemary Beach, Cafe 30A and Surfing Deer in Seagrove. These are pretty fancy dinner restaurants that are amazingggg.


If you just want some quick good food, The Big Chill has a million different options and is so good! Any of the food trucks in the square are also good, as well as Fondville Bakery in Alys Beach!
